(WKOW) – The CDC has offered new guidance on travel during the winter break 2020.

First and foremost, the agency advised against it.

However, the CDC has said that if you must travel, consider taking coronavirus tests before and after your trip.

Any travel-related increase in vacation cases will likely be seen a week to ten days after the vacation.

The CDC director called the next three months “more difficult” for public health in the United States.
